ArtCAM Pro 8.1 was engineered primarily for Windows XP and Windows 2000 environments. When running the software on modern 64-bit platforms like Windows 10 or Windows 11, the system's strict memory management and User Account Control (UAC) layouts can prevent ArtCAMPro.exe from acquiring the authorization required to execute 32-bit subsystem DLLs. 3. Modern antivirus programs often flag this specific legacy DLL file as a threat and quarantine it.
ArtCAM was fully discontinued by Autodesk, meaning it no longer receives security patches, feature updates, or official technical support.
